Expansion at Kingman Industrial Park

KINGMAN – Shelves West, LLC. an American plastics company has leased 100,000 sq. ft. of space in the Kingman Logistics Center at the Kingman Airport and Industrial Park.

“We have been investing in new equipment and expanding our plastic injection molding production, which created a need for additional space for inventory and distribution,” according to Robert Bridewell, Plant Manager.  “The leased area is convenient to our facility and provides an immediate solution for our growth along with meeting our projected needs for the future.”

With this expansion, Shelves West, LLC anticipates investing an additional $10.5 million and hiring an additional 20 employees at its Kingman location over the next six months.

Formally Knauf Insulation, the Kingman Logistics Center is a rail served property with 620,000 sq. ft. of contemporary industrial and distribution space under roof.  Mr. Dan Smith, SIOR, said, “Big Industrial, LLC has been invested in the Kingman area for nearly 20 years, so when this property became available last year, it made strategic sense to acquire, upgrade and offer it to the manufacturing/warehousing community. We are excited Shelves West chose a portion of our building for their expansion.”

“Given the issues with COVID-19 over the last 6 months, it is refreshing to see continued capital investment and new employment opportunities within the Kingman Airport Industrial Park,” stated Bennett Bratley, Economic Development Manager, City of Kingman. This activity just confirms that Kingman is located to provide access to Southwestern markets such as Los Angeles, Las Vegas, Phoenix and Tucson.
